There are a lot of CVE vulnerabilities in the TDA4 linux SDK, Our customers need us to fix all of these vulnerabilities, we can find some patch in yocto website, but most of these vulnerabilities patches can't be found in yocto website, for these, How did you deal with it?

    linux_kernel 5.4.106 CVE-2023-0461 There is a use-after-free vulnerability in the Linux Kernel which can be exploited to achieve local privilege escalation. To reach the vulnerability kernel configuration flag CONFIG_TLS or CONFIG_XFRM_ESPINTCP has to be configured, but the operation does not require any privilege.

    There is a use-after-free bug of icsk_ulp_data of a struct inet_connection_sock.

    When CONFIG_TLS is enabled, user can install a tls context (struct tls_context) on a connected tcp socket. The context is not cleared if this socket is disconnected and reused as a listener. If a new socket is created from the listener, the context is inherited and vulnerable.

    The setsockopt TCP_ULP operation does not require any privilege.

    We recommend upgrading past commit 2c02d41d71f90a5168391b6a5f2954112ba2307c
    2023-02-28T15:15Z

    linux_kernel 5.4.106 CVE-2022-3176 There exists a use-after-free in io_uring in the Linux kernel. Signalfd_poll() and binder_poll() use a waitqueue whose lifetime is the current task. It will send a POLLFREE notification to all waiters before the queue is freed. Unfortunately, the io_uring poll doesn't handle POLLFREE. This allows a use-after-free to occur if a signalfd or binder fd is polled with io_uring poll, and the waitqueue gets freed. We recommend upgrading past commit fc78b2fc21f10c4c9c4d5d659a685710ffa63659 2022-09-16T14:15Z

    linux_kernel 5.4.106 CVE-2023-4207 A use-after-free vulnerability in the Linux kernel's net/sched: cls_fw component can be exploited to achieve local privilege escalation.

    When fw_change() is called on an existing filter, the whole tcf_result struct is always copied into the new instance of the filter. This causes a problem when updating a filter bound to a class, as tcf_unbind_filter() is always called on the old instance in the success path, decreasing filter_cnt of the still referenced class and allowing it to be deleted, leading to a use-after-free.

    We recommend upgrading past commit 76e42ae831991c828cffa8c37736ebfb831ad5ec.
    2023-09-06T14:15Z

    linux_kernel 5.4.106 CVE-2023-4622 A use-after-free vulnerability in the Linux kernel's af_unix component can be exploited to achieve local privilege escalation.

    The unix_stream_sendpage() function tries to add data to the last skb in the peer's recv queue without locking the queue. Thus there is a race where unix_stream_sendpage() could access an skb locklessly that is being released by garbage collection, resulting in use-after-free.

    We recommend upgrading past commit 790c2f9d15b594350ae9bca7b236f2b1859de02c.
    2023-09-06T14:15Z

    These are generic Linux kernel fixes. Typically the fixes are sent pushed to the older kernel branches as well. One thing that will help is to migrate to the latest LTS branch of the kernel and check for the fixes.

  • But linux keneral for TDA4  is used yocto compiling environment, How does generic linux kernel fixes apply to TDA4? Do you have some fix suggestions? or Do you have already done in yocto website?

  • Zhu,

    Based on the LTS kernel version that you are using. Example: 9.x SDK has the 6.1 kernel version. You will need to pull the upstream lts stable branch on top. We have the SDK branched out of 6.1 tag.
